Ghidra is a powerful tool for analyzing software code, created by the National Security Agency. It helps users understand and analyze compiled code on various platforms like Windows, macOS, and Linux. With features like disassembly, decompilation, and scripting, Ghidra is useful for identifying vulnerabilities in software. You can customize it with your own scripts and extensions using Java or Python. This tool is beneficial because it provides deep insights into malicious code, helping protect networks and systems from cyber threats. However, be aware of potential security vulnerabilities in certain versions and follow the installation guides carefully.

This tool, called `mitmproxy2swagger`, helps you automatically create API documentation from the traffic your apps generate. Here’s how it benefits you:

You can capture the HTTP traffic of your apps using `mitmproxy` or browser DevTools, and then convert this traffic into OpenAPI 3.0 specifications. This process is automated, so you don't need to manually write the API documentation. You can run the tool multiple times with different captures, and it will merge the data safely. The tool also allows you to add example data and headers to the requests and responses, making your API documentation more comprehensive. This saves time and effort in documenting your APIs accurately.

Apktool is a tool that helps you modify and understand Android apps. It can decode and rebuild app files, making it easier to add new features, localize apps, or support custom platforms. You can debug the app's code step-by-step and work with a project-like file structure, which simplifies tasks like building the app. This tool is meant for legal uses only, such as improving apps or adding new features, and it helps developers work more efficiently with Android applications.

LLM4Decompile is a powerful tool that helps convert binary code back into readable C source code. It uses large language models to decompile Linux x86_64 binaries, supporting different optimization levels. The tool has various models with high re-executability rates, meaning the decompiled code can often run correctly and pass tests. You can easily use it by following the quick start guide, which includes steps to set up the environment, preprocess the binary, and decompile it into C code. This tool is beneficial because it saves time and effort in understanding complex binary code, making it easier to analyze and modify software.

IPATool is a helpful tool that lets you search for iOS apps on the App Store and download their IPA files directly to your computer. It works on Windows, Linux, and macOS. To use it, you need an Apple ID. The tool allows you to authenticate with the App Store, search for apps, purchase licenses if needed, and download IPA files legally. This is useful for backing up apps or modifying them before installing them on your device. IPATool ensures that only purchased apps can be downloaded, making it a secure way to manage your iOS apps.

LunaTranslator is a tool that helps translate Japanese visual novels. It supports various translation engines and can automatically find text in games, making it easier to use than older tools like Textractor. You can also use OCR (Optical Character Recognition) for scanning text from images. The software allows you to output translated text to the clipboard or other programs. This makes playing untranslated games much simpler and more enjoyable. Additionally, it offers features like speech synthesis and support for learning Japanese by displaying furigana and looking up words in dictionaries.

ReVanced Patches let you customize Android apps by adding new features, blocking ads, changing how apps look, and more. You can remove annoying ads, personalize app themes, enable background playback, and unlock extra controls. Using tools like ReVanced Manager, you can easily apply these patches without technical hassle. This means you get a cleaner, more enjoyable app experience, especially for apps like YouTube, without paying for premium versions. It also supports ongoing updates and a community that keeps improving it, so your apps stay fresh and tailored to your needs.
